Разрешение изменения видимости проекта в организации - GitHub Enterprise Server 37 Docs

Разрешение изменения видимости проекта в организации - GitHub Enterprise Server 37 Docs
На чтение
196 мин.
Просмотров
16
Дата обновления
27.02.2025
#COURSE##INNER#

Разрешение изменения видимости проекта в организации - GitHub Enterprise Server 37 Docs

Веб-разработка и совместная работа в сфере программирования становятся все более популярными. Множество разработчиков и организаций используют инструменты, такие как GitHub, чтобы хранить и обмениваться своими проектами. Однако, при работе в команде возникает необходимость управлять доступом к проектам и контролировать их видимость.

GitHub Enterprise Server 3.7 Docs обеспечивает высокий уровень безопасности и возможность настраивать видимость проектов. Организации могут создавать и настраивать проекты, репозитории и комманды, чтобы определить, кто может просматривать, клонировать, изменять или удалять проекты.

Для управления доступом к проектам, GitHub Enterprise Server 3.7 Docs предлагает гибкую систему прав, которая позволяет администраторам определить перечень авторизованных пользователей или групп, а также уровень доступа каждого пользователя или группы к проектам организации.

Например, администратор может создать команду разработчиков, которым будет разрешен полный доступ к определенным проектам, в то время как другим пользователям будет предоставлен только доступ на чтение.

GitHub Enterprise Server 3.7 Docs предоставляет возможность централизованного управления правами доступа к проектам, что позволяет организациям быть уверенными в безопасности своих данных и задач.

Видимость проекта в организации

Видимость проекта в организации влияет на то, кто может видеть и управлять проектом. На GitHub Enterprise Server доступны три уровня видимости проекта: общедоступный, ограниченный и приватный.

Общедоступный проект доступен для всех пользователей в организации и может быть виден и клонирован другими организациями и пользователями вне организации.

Ограниченный проект доступен только для определенных участников организации. Неучастники организации не смогут видеть или клонировать этот проект.

Приватный проект является наиболее защищенным уровнем видимости. Этот проект доступен только для участников организации, которые имеют соответствующие разрешения.

Вы можете изменять уровень видимости проекта в настройках проекта. Выберите нужный уровень видимости, чтобы управлять доступом к проекту и контролировать, кто может видеть и работать с ним.

Уровень видимости Описание
Общедоступный Доступен для всех пользователей в организации и может быть виден другими организациями и пользователями
Ограниченный Доступен только для определенных участников организации, не виден для неучастников организации
Приватный Доступен только для участников организации с соответствующими разрешениями

Разрешение изменения видимости проекта является важным аспектом организации работы в GitHub Enterprise Server 3.7 Docs. В данной статье рассмотрим, как настроить разрешение изменения видимости проекта в организации.

В GitHub Enterprise Server 3.7 Docs существует возможность настраивать видимость проектов в рамках вашей организации. Это очень полезная функция, которая позволяет контролировать доступ к проектам и управлять ими с разной степенью ограничений.

Для изменения видимости проекта вам потребуется быть администратором организации или иметь соответствующие права доступа. Перейдите в веб-интерфейс GitHub Enterprise Server 3.7 Docs и откройте страницу настроек вашей организации.

На странице настроек найдите раздел "Управление видимостью проектов" или аналогичный раздел с похожим названием. В этом разделе вы сможете увидеть список проектов вашей организации и текущую видимость каждого проекта.

Для изменения видимости проекта щелкните по нему и выберите нужный вариант из выпадающего меню. Обычно доступны следующие варианты:

  • Видимость только для организации: проект будет виден только членам вашей организации.
  • Видимость только для определенных команд: проект будет виден только выбранным командам внутри вашей организации.
  • Публичная видимость: проект будет виден всем пользователям GitHub, включая пользователей извне вашей организации.

Выбрав нужный вариант, сохраните изменения. Видимость проекта будет обновлена и станет соответствовать вашим настройкам.

Настроить разрешение изменения видимости проекта в GitHub Enterprise Server 3.7 Docs позволяет эффективно управлять доступом к проектам и обеспечить безопасность информации. Будьте внимательны при настройке и выбирайте видимость, которая соответствует потребностям вашей организации.

Управление доступом

Управление доступом

GitHub Enterprise Server предоставляет возможность гибко управлять доступом к вашим проектам внутри организации. Вы можете легко настраивать видимость каждого проекта и определять, кто может просматривать, комментировать или редактировать его.

Для управления доступом к проектам в GitHub Enterprise Server вы можете использовать следующие инструменты:

1. Команды: Вы можете создавать команды внутри своей организации и добавлять участников в эти команды. Затем вы можете назначать командам определенные роли с различными правами доступа к проектам. Это позволяет упростить управление доступом, особенно в больших организациях с множеством участников.

2. Роли: В GitHub Enterprise Server есть несколько предопределенных ролей с различными наборами прав доступа. Вы можете назначать роли отдельным участникам или командам, чтобы указать, какие действия они могут выполнять с проектами. Например, вы можете назначить члену команды роль "Читатель", чтобы он мог только просматривать проекты, или роль "Администратор", чтобы он имел полный доступ к редактированию и управлению проектами.

3. Группы: Группы позволяют вам объединять участников вместе и управлять доступом к проектам для нескольких участников одновременно. Вы можете создавать группы, назначать им роли и просто назначать группы для проектов, чтобы определить, кто имеет доступ к ним.

С помощью этих инструментов вы можете точно настроить доступ к вашим проектам в GitHub Enterprise Server и обеспечить безопасность и конфиденциальность данных вашей организации.

Для управления доступом в организации можно использовать следующие возможности:

Для управления доступом в организации можно использовать следующие возможности:

1. Приглашения: Вы можете отправлять приглашения пользователям, чтобы они присоединились к вашей организации. Приглашения могут быть ограничены по времени или разрешены только для пользователей с определенным адресом электронной почты.

2. Роли: GitHub Enterprise Server предоставляет различные роли пользователей, которые определяют их возможности в рамках организации. Варианты ролей включают владельцев, администраторов и участников.

3. Ограничения доступа: В высоконагруженных организациях вы можете ограничить доступ к вашему репозиторию по IP-адресам или диапазонам IP-адресов. Это обеспечит дополнительный уровень безопасности.

4. Одобрение запросов на включение: При настройке вашей организации вы можете включить функцию "Одобрение запросов на включение", чтобы контролировать, какие пользователи могут стать членами вашей организации.

5. Организационные команды: Вы можете создавать команды внутри вашей организации и назначать пользователям в эти команды. Это позволяет более точно управлять доступом к репозиториям и задачам.

Возможность Описание
Приглашения Отправка приглашений пользователям с ограничениями по времени или почтовому адресу
Роли Определение ролей пользователей в организации
Ограничения доступа Ограничение доступа к репозиторию по IP-адресам
Одобрение запросов на включение Контроль, какие пользователи могут стать членами организации
Организационные команды Создание команд и управление доступом к репозиториям и задачам

Назначение ролей пользователей.

В GitHub Enterprise Server существуют различные роли, которые могут быть назначены пользователям организации. Каждая роль определяет уровень доступа и разрешений пользователя в проекте.

Роль Описание
Владелец Владелец проекта имеет полный контроль над репозиториями и правами доступа пользователей. Он может приглашать, удалять и назначать пользователей на различные роли.
Администратор Администратор имеет почти все права и возможности, как и владелец, но без возможности изменения ролей и прав других пользователей.
Разработчик Разработчик имеет доступ для просмотра и изменения репозиториев. Он может коммитить изменения, открывать и закрывать запросы на слияние и управлять ветками.
Приглашенный Приглашенный пользователь имеет ограниченные возможности и доступ только к определенным репозиториям. Он может только просматривать код без возможности изменения.

Разделение ролей пользователей позволяет эффективно управлять доступом и контролировать права пользователей в рамках организации. В зависимости от проекта и его требований, каждой роли может быть назначен определенный набор разрешений и ограничений.

Создание команд и назначение пользователей в команды.

GitHub Enterprise Server предоставляет возможность создавать команды и назначать пользователей в эти команды. Команды позволяют организациям управлять доступом к своим проектам и репозиториям, а также эффективно сотрудничать и организовывать работу команды.

Для создания команды в GitHub Enterprise Server нужно выполнить следующие шаги:

  1. Зайдите в свою учетную запись GitHub Enterprise Server и откройте страницу вашей организации.
  2. Выберите вкладку "Teams" в верхней части страницы и нажмите кнопку "New team".
  3. Введите имя команды и описание, если требуется, и выберите уровень доступа для команды (например, "Read", "Write" или "Admin").
  4. Нажмите кнопку "Create team", чтобы создать команду.

После создания команды можно назначать пользователей в эту команду. Для этого нужно:

  1. Выберите команду, к которой хотите добавить пользователей, на странице "Teams" в вашей организации.
  2. Нажмите кнопку "Add a member" возле списка участников команды.
  3. Введите имя пользователя, которого вы хотите добавить, и нажмите кнопку "Add to team".

Теперь пользователь будет иметь доступ к проектам и репозиториям, которые доступны для команды.

Вы также можете использовать команды для управления доступом пользователей к проектам и репозиториям в масштабе организации. Например, вы можете назначить команду "Admin" для репозитория, чтобы дать ей полный доступ к изменению проекта.

Создание команд и назначение пользователей в команды в GitHub Enterprise Server предоставляет гибкую и удобную систему управления доступом, которая облегчает сотрудничество и координацию работ в организации.

Настройка видимости

Настройка видимости проекта в GitHub Enterprise Server позволяет управлять доступом к проекту внутри организации. Видимость проекта может быть открытой, приватной или внутренней.

Видимость Описание
Открытая (Public) Проект виден всем пользователям, а также поисковым системам. Любой пользователь может форкнуть проект или делать запросы на слияние изменений.
Приватная (Private) Проект виден только пользователям, которым был предоставлен доступ. Доступ могут получить только члены организации и выбранные сотрудники.
Внутренняя (Internal) Проект виден только пользователям организации. Доступ могут получить все члены организации, но не пользователи извне.

Для изменения видимости проекта необходимо перейти в настройки проекта и выбрать нужный уровень видимости. Видимость может быть изменена только администраторами проекта.

Вы можете настроить видимость проекта в организации следующими способами:

1. Публичная видимость:

Если установлен режим публичной видимости для проекта, любой пользователь может просматривать его и участвовать в нем без ограничений. Это наиболее подходящая опция, если вы хотите открыть доступ к проекту для всех пользователей организации.

2. С внешними сотрудниками:

Вы можете добавлять в проект внешних сотрудников, чтобы они могли просматривать и работать с ним. Внешние сотрудники могут быть приглашены для сотрудничества в проекте, независимо от их принадлежности к организации. Однако, они не получают доступ к другим проектам в организации.

3. Внутренняя видимость:

Если вы хотите ограничить доступ к проекту только для внутренних сотрудников организации, вы можете установить внутреннюю видимость. Только участники организации смогут просматривать и участвовать в проекте. Это полезно, когда вам нужно сделать проект приватным.

Комбинирование этих способов позволит гибко настраивать видимость проекта в организации в зависимости от ваших нужд и требований.

Вопрос-ответ:

Можно ли изменить видимость проекта в GitHub Enterprise Server?

Да, в GitHub Enterprise Server можно изменить видимость проекта. Вы можете выбрать из трех видимостей: открытый, частично открытый или приватный.

Как изменить видимость проекта в GitHub Enterprise Server?

Чтобы изменить видимость проекта в GitHub Enterprise Server, нужно зайти в настройки проекта, выбрать вкладку "Options" и найти секцию "Visibility". В этой секции вы сможете выбрать новую видимость проекта.

Какие варианты видимости проекта доступны в GitHub Enterprise Server?

В GitHub Enterprise Server доступны три варианта видимости проекта: открытый (public), частично открытый (internal) и приватный (private). Открытые проекты видны всем пользователям, частично открытые - только участникам организации, приватные - только создателю проекта и участникам, которым он разрешил доступ.

Можно ли изменить видимость проекта после его создания в GitHub Enterprise Server?

Да, в GitHub Enterprise Server можно изменить видимость проекта после его создания. Для этого нужно зайти в настройки проекта, выбрать вкладку "Options" и найти секцию "Visibility". Там вы сможете изменить видимость проекта.

Какие последствия могут быть при изменении видимости проекта в GitHub Enterprise Server?

Изменение видимости проекта может повлиять на доступ пользователей к проекту. Если проект был открытым, а станет приватным, то пользователи, которым не разрешен доступ, больше не смогут видеть проект и его содержимое. Если проект станет открытым, то все пользователи смогут видеть его и его содержимое.

Как изменить видимость проекта в GitHub Enterprise Server?

Для изменения видимости проекта в GitHub Enterprise Server, вам необходимо быть администратором проекта или иметь достаточные права доступа. Вы можете изменить видимость проекта, выбрав нужные настройки в разделе Settings (Настройки) вашего проекта. В разделе "Danger Zone" (Опасная зона) выберите пункт "Change repository visibility" (Изменить видимость репозитория) и выберите нужную опцию: Public (Общедоступный), Private (Частный) или Internal (Внутренний).

Видео:

github как залить проект.Как пользоваться github.

github как залить проект.Как пользоваться github. by Дмитрий Тхоржевский 35,477 views 1 year ago 13 minutes, 52 seconds

0 Комментариев
Комментариев на модерации: 0
Оставьте комментарий